The Giza Governorate's campaign focused on cracking down on markets and supply and commercial establishments. It resulted in the arrest of 2,437 various cases and the seizure of more than 283 tons and 204 kilograms of violative goods. Additionally, large quantities of subsidized flour, petroleum products, oils, and feed were seized. The issues identified included commercial fraud, manipulation of product quality, unlicensed bakery operations, violations in the sale of subsidized materials, and monopolization of petroleum products. The governorate affirms that intensive monitoring campaigns will continue to identify violations and combat all forms of fraud and commercial deception, in order to protect citizens' rights.
